Training a kitten to sit is a process that requires patience and positive reinforcement. Here are steps you can follow:
- Start in a quiet and comfortable area with minimal distractions.
- Hold a small treat close to your kitten’s nose, allowing them to smell it.
- Slowly raise the treat above their head, which will cause their bottom to lower naturally.
- As their bottom touches the ground, say the command “sit” and give them the treat immediately.
- Repeat this process several times, gradually removing the treat from your hand and using only the verbal command.
- Be consistent with the command and reward every time your kitten successfully sits.
- Keep training sessions short and frequent, as kittens have short attention spans.
- Practice in different locations and gradually introduce distractions to help your kitten generalize the behavior.
- Always use positive reinforcement and avoid punishment or force. Remember, training takes time, so be patient and consistent with your kitten.

Understanding the Basics of Kitten Training
To effectively train your kitten, start by understanding the basics of kitten training. Training your kitten is an important part of their development and can help establish a strong bond between you and your furry friend. Here are some key points to consider:
- Positive reinforcement: Using positive reinforcement techniques, such as treats and praise, is essential in kitten training. This helps encourage good behavior and creates a positive association with training.
- Clicker training: Introducing clicker training to kittens can be a fun and effective way to teach them new behaviors. The clicker serves as a signal for the desired behavior, followed by a reward. This method helps kittens understand what’s expected of them and reinforces positive behaviors.
- Consistency: Consistency is key when training your kitten. Establish clear rules and boundaries and stick to them. This helps your kitten understand what behaviors are acceptable and what’re not.
- Patience: Remember that kittens are learning and may not grasp commands right away. Be patient and understanding, and always reward their efforts.
- Playtime: Incorporate training into playtime sessions. By making training fun and interactive, your kitten will be more motivated to learn and participate.
Step-by-Step Guide to Training Your Kitten to Sit
Start by luring your kitten with a treat, and then reinforce the behavior with praise and rewards, so that they can learn to sit on command.
Teaching a kitten to sit is an essential part of their training, as it helps to establish boundaries and instill discipline.
To begin, hold a treat close to their nose and slowly move it upwards, causing them to naturally sit down. As soon as their bottom touches the ground, give them the treat and offer enthusiastic praise.
Repeat this process several times a day, gradually phasing out the treat and relying solely on verbal cues and positive reinforcement.
If you encounter a stubborn kitten, try using a clicker or breaking down the training into smaller steps.
Remember to be patient and consistent, as kittens thrive on routine and repetition.

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them
If you’re facing common challenges while training your kitten to sit, don’t worry, there are effective strategies to overcome them.
Training a kitten can be a rewarding experience, but it can also come with its fair share of obstacles. Here are some tips to help you overcome distractions and deal with stubbornness:
- Create a quiet and calm environment: Minimize noise and distractions during training sessions to help your kitten focus.
- Use positive reinforcement: Reward your kitten with treats and praise whenever they successfully sit on command.
- Break the training into small steps: Start by teaching your kitten to follow a treat with their eyes, then gradually move on to luring them into a sitting position.
- Be patient and consistent: Training takes time, so be patient and consistent with your commands and rewards.
- Seek professional help if needed: If you’re struggling to make progress, don’t hesitate to consult a professional trainer for guidance.

Taking Your Kitten’s Training to the Next Level
You can continue building on your kitten’s training by introducing more complex commands, like ‘stay’ and ‘come’, to further enhance their obedience skills.
To take their training to the next level, consider incorporating the ‘sit’ command into other commands. This advanced training technique won’t only reinforce their understanding of ‘sit’, but also help them learn to listen and follow instructions in different contexts.
For example, you can teach your kitten to sit before receiving their meals or treats, before going outside, or before receiving affection. By incorporating ‘sit’ into these everyday situations, you’ll strengthen their overall obedience and responsiveness.
Remember to be patient and consistent with your training, rewarding your kitten with praise and treats when they successfully perform the ‘sit’ command in different scenarios. With time and practice, your kitten will become a well-trained and obedient companion.
